The Current State of Online Banking (Advanced Strategies)
The current state of online banking is marked by a shift towards digital channels, with many banks investing heavily in mobile banking apps and online platforms. However, despite this shift, many online banking systems still rely on outdated security measures, such as passwords and PINs, which are increasingly vulnerable to cyber threats. Advanced strategies, such as biometric authentication and artificial intelligence-powered security systems, are becoming increasingly popular as a means of enhancing security and efficiency.
A key challenge facing online banking is the need to balance security with convenience. Many users are reluctant to adopt advanced security measures, such as two-factor authentication, due to concerns about complexity and inconvenience. However, with the rise of biometric authentication and other advanced security technologies, it is possible to enhance security without compromising convenience.
